Why isn't my golden mystery snail growing?

Posted: 29 Feb 2020 06:54 PM PST

I bought four snails at the exact same time in November. I made sure to get dime sized ones so that they could grow up in the tank. There is cuttlebone in the filter and they are given a new veggie to eat every other day. It usually takes them two days to eat their food which is why I do every other day. The tank is 74° - 76°. I have two snails in one five gallon and two in another five gallon. My other snails have grown to the size a little over a quarter while this little yellow guy is still the size of a dime. Their shell growths are seamless and healthy while his is clearly unhealthy. This past week I have started putting him directly on whatever veggie I pop in the tank. Yes the veggies are blanched. They get a mixture of french green beans and carrots. I put in one veggie per snail.

Any suggestions on what his deal is? I don't like seeing him struggle like this.
